Recover your account:
Steam Support page about Account Recovery
You must be logged out of all accounts to start the account recovery process.
You don't need access to the email, phone or password currently tied to the hijacked/hacked/stolen/lost account for this to work. Just pick the "I do not have access..." or a similar option when asked.
The recovery process allows you to provide proof of ownership.

This can be a CDkey you've activated on steam, like old orange box cd or other old games, like doom, unreal tournament and so on. Or, a cc number you've used for purchases, or a phone number linked to the account, or a receipt of a topup transaction.
If you don't have that, going through the recovery process will get you stuck on this. Even if you have access to the old email, that's not enough.
